Whole-Wheat Buttermilk Pancakes
Vita + Shek July 23, 2022Ingredients
For about 5 pancakes
Whole Wheat Flour | 1.5 cups (225g) |
Baking Powder | 1 tbsp |
Vegan Butter sub: regular oil | 2 tbsp (27g) |
Soy Milk | 1 cup |
Apple Cider Vinegar | 1.5 tbsp |
Sweetner Jaggery/Brown Sugar/Maple Syrup | 2 tbsp |
Powdered Flax Seed | 1 tbsp |
Vanilla Extract | 1 - 2 tsp |

Process
-
Prepare the Buttermilk
Mix soy milk and ACV and let stand for 5 - 10 minutes
-
Prepare flax egg
Boil 3 tbsp water and mix with powdered flax seeds, and let stand for 5 - 10 minutes
-
Mix, but do not overmix
Mix everything together into a thick batter, adding water as necessary
There should not be any dry clumps, but it is okay to be lumpy
You do not want an overly uniform or thin/runny mixture

Notes
Cast Iron or Carbon Steel pans are excellent for making pancakes with minimal oil every 3 - 4 rounds. If possible, avoid using non-stick pans. In fact, just don't use non-stick any more.
